Begrenzung der Nutzung einer Ressource (Speicher, Speicherplatz, CPU-Zeit, geöffnete Dateien, Netzwerkbandbreite usw.) durch einen Prozess oder eine Gruppe von Prozessen.
Benötigen Änderungen /etc/security/limits.confeinen Neustart, bevor sie wirksam werden? Wenn ich beispielsweise ein Skript habe, in dem die folgenden Grenzwerte festgelegt sind /etc/security/limits.conf, muss das System neu gestartet werden, damit diese Grenzwerte wirksam werden? * hard nofile 94000 * soft nofile 94000 * hard nproc 64000 * soft nproc 64000
Im Moment weiß ich, wie man: Suchlimit für offene Dateien pro Prozess: ulimit -n Zählen Sie alle geöffneten Dateien von allen Prozessen: lsof | wc -l Erhalte die maximal erlaubte Anzahl offener Dateien: cat /proc/sys/fs/file-max Meine Frage ist: Warum gibt es in Linux ein Limit für offene Dateien?
Gibt es eine Möglichkeit, die Anzahl der auf einem lsBefehl aufgelisteten Dateien zu begrenzen ? Ich habe gesehen: ls | head -4 aber zu erhalten headoder tailausgeführt werden , ich brauche zu warten lsbis zum Ende der Ausführung, und mit Verzeichnissen mit einer enormen Menge von Dateien , die erhebliche …
Ich habe also 4 GB RAM + 4 GB Swap. Ich möchte einen Benutzer mit eingeschränktem RAM und Swap erstellen: 3 GB RAM und 1 GB Swap. Ist so etwas möglich? Ist es möglich, Anwendungen mit begrenztem RAM zu starten und diese auszutauschen, ohne einen separaten Benutzer zu erstellen (und …
Ich verwende einen Docker-Server unter Arch Linux (Kernel 4.3.3-2) mit mehreren Containern. Seit meinem letzten Neustart stürzen sowohl der Docker-Server als auch zufällige Programme in den Containern mit der Meldung ab, dass kein Thread erstellt werden kann oder (seltener) ein Zweig erstellt werden muss. Die spezifische Fehlermeldung ist je nach …
Wir haben einen Ubuntu 12.04 Server mit httpd auf Port 80 und wir wollen einschränken: die maximalen Verbindungen pro IP-Adresse zu httpd bis 10 die maximale Anzahl neuer Verbindungen pro Sekunde zu httpd bis 150 Wie können wir das mit iptables machen?
Ich betreibe ein Linux-System, das viele Benutzer hat, aber manchmal tritt ein Missbrauch auf. Hier kann ein Benutzer einen einzelnen Prozess ausführen, der mehr als 80% der CPU / des Speichers beansprucht. Gibt es eine Möglichkeit, dies zu verhindern, indem die CPU-Auslastung, die ein Prozess verbrauchen kann (beispielsweise auf 10%)? …
Ich kann ulimit verwenden, aber ich denke, das betrifft nur meine Shell-Sitzung. Ich möchte, dass das Limit für alle Prozesse erhöht wird. Dies ist auf Red Hat.
Ich suche nach einer Möglichkeit, eine Prozessfestplatte auf eine festgelegte Geschwindigkeitsbegrenzung zu beschränken. Im Idealfall würde das Programm folgendermaßen funktionieren: $ limitio --pid 32423 --write-limit 1M Begrenzung von Prozess 32423 auf 1 Megabyte pro Sekunde Schreibgeschwindigkeit der Festplatte.
Gibt es eine Methode, um den Kopiervorgang unter Linux zu verlangsamen? Ich habe eine große Datei, sagen wir 10 GB, und ich möchte sie in ein anderes Verzeichnis kopieren, aber ich möchte sie nicht mit voller Geschwindigkeit kopieren. Nehmen wir an, ich möchte es mit einer Geschwindigkeit von 1 MB …
Ist es möglich, die weiche und harte Grenze eines bestimmten Prozesses zu ändern ? In meinem Fall lautet mein Prozess mongodund viele Webressourcen fordern mich auf, einfach Folgendes auszuführen: ulimit -n <my new value> Meine aktuellen Gedanken: Wie erkennt der Befehl das Limit des Prozesses , den ich ändern werde? …
Ich habe einen Entwickler-Server, auf dem sshdmanchmal nicht mehr funktioniert, weil der Computer keinen RAM mehr hat. Ja, der Arbeitsspeicher geht zur Neige, und ein Upgrade ist derzeit nicht möglich. Ich möchte dem Computer sagen: "Tun Sie, was immer Sie wollen, aber lassen Sie 20 MB und etwas CPU weg …
Ich stelle den nofileWert /etc/security/limits.conffür meinen Oracle-Benutzer ein und habe eine Frage zu dessen Verhalten: nofileBeschränkt die Gesamtzahl der Dateien, die der Benutzer für alle Prozesse öffnen kann , oder die Gesamtzahl der Dateien, die der Benutzer haben kann offen für jeden seiner Prozesse? Insbesondere für die folgende Verwendung: oracle …
Ich erwäge, btrfs auf meinem Datenlaufwerk zu verwenden, damit ich Snapper oder so etwas wie Snapper verwenden kann, um zeitbasierte Snapshots zu erstellen. Ich glaube, dass ich damit alte Versionen meiner Daten durchsuchen kann. Dies käme zu meiner aktuellen Offsite-Sicherung hinzu, da bei einem Laufwerksfehler die Daten und die Snapshots …
We use cookies and other tracking technologies to improve your browsing experience on our website,
to show you personalized content and targeted ads, to analyze our website traffic,
and to understand where our visitors are coming from.
By continuing, you consent to our use of cookies and other tracking technologies and
affirm you're at least 16 years old or have consent from a parent or guardian.